Phytoseiid mites of the subtribe Amblyseiina (Acari: Phytoseiidae: Amblyseiini) from sub-Saharan Africa

This is the fifth publication in a series to determine the phytoseiid mites of sub-Saharan Africa. Thirty-one phytoseiid species of the subtribe Amblyseiina are reported in this paper. They refer to all species of this subtribe known to occur in sub-Saharan Africa. Ten of these species are described for the first time, 15 species are redescribed and 6 are not evaluated in this study. Most of those species were collected in cassava habitat in tropical Africa and in other habitats in South Africa. A key is included to help in the separation of these species.
